Cochrane, W, (William)
William Cochrane papers, 1921-1971.
Full record of his undergraduate and graduate lectures, classes, and laboratory exercises at the University of Glasgow, including names of professors and lecturers. Also full notes of courses attended and lectures given by Cochrane on radar during the 1939-1945 World War. Substantial but less well-ordered notes for lectures at Imperial College, London, before and after the war, and for his period at St Thomas'. Some correspondence; includes some letters from M. von Laue, 1936-1937.
Medical physicist. Lecturer, Imperial College of Science & Technology, London, 1934-1939. Worked on radar at various research establishments (mainly Telecommunications Research Establishment at Malvern, Worcestershire, England) during the 1939-1945 World War. In 1952 became Head, Imperial College, St Thomas' Hospital Medical School (London) Department of Physics.
